Abstract

The in vitro DES conjugation reaction with glucuronic acid in golden hamster and rat liver homogenates has been made evident. The measurement of UDP-glucuronyl transferase activity has been done by photocolorimetric determination of DES consumed after an incubation period with the homogenate. DESGA has been chromatographically and enzymatically identified as a reaction product. A comparative study of activity in male rat, male, castrated male and female hamsters and in the same type of hamsters a week after a 25 mg DES pellet implantation, has been done. In absence of UDPGA there is practically no DES consumption in any one of the cases. Of all variables under study: sex, castration, implantation and species, only this last one determines DES consumption differences of high statistical significance. Hamster liver consumes six times as much DES as that consumed by rat liver. The role of liver in renal tumour processes in hamster by DES is discussed.
